About Removery:
Join us at Removery - the global leader in laser tattoo removal. We aim to normalize tattoo removal and empower people to feel comfortable in their skin. We provide the highest quality of service and care at every stage of our clients’ removal or fading journeys.
Removery was formed in 2019 through a merge of the four leading tattoo removal brands. Now, with more than 150 studios located in the United States, Canada, and Australia, and over 2 million successful treatments to date – we’ve raised the standard for the entire industry.
Using best-in-class innovative PicoWay® laser technology, we ensure safe and effective tattoo removal. The foundation is in place continue growing globally, as we are committed to making tattoo removal safe and accessible to as many people as we can.
